| + | AOUT modules generate **Analog (Control) Voltages (and gate signals)** *. It provides **8 control voltage (CV) outputs with 12 bit resolution and 2 gate outputs**. It is used by various MIDIbox projects to control analog synthesizers and/or FX gear. | ||

| + | The **MAX525 DACs** feature better performance than the one used on the [[AOUT_NG]]. **So for perfectionists wanting to drive analog VCOs with maximum tuning precision, the AOUT is the right choice**. Bipolar operation is possible but needs some external parts. Althought, MAX525 is quite expensive and has limited availability. | ||
